I wrote this book because it upsets me to see waste. That's waste of money; waste of time; waste of knowledge. And not just mine either - anybody's.Although the future is never exactly like the past, I believe that there are usually enough similarities between the two for our past experience to provide us with clues on how we could approach the future more productively - if only we knew how to find those clues, decode them and apply them. Organisations that run projects have experience and useful knowledge passing right under their noses every day, but so often the value in this experience goes to waste because of a failure to take appropriate action. This book attempts to address why this happens, and to offer to Project Managers (PMs) and Project Management Office (PMO) people some suggestions as to how to improve the way your organisations learns lessons from projects. A key component of successful project management is the ability to glean key learnings from the experience throughout the lifecycle of the project, as well as at its conclusion. However, in practice, the lessons learned from a specific project are rarely incorporated into an organization's overall policies and procedures. Without a concerted effort to reflect on specific project learning's and a designated process to implement them across the organization, lessons are lost, mistakes are repeated and opportunities for operational efficiency are missed.

Project management has been practiced for thousands of years, but only recently have organizations begun to apply systematic management tools and techniques to manage complex projects. Today's approaches to project management can be traced directly to methodologies designed by the U.S. military and Department of Defense in the years after World War II. Subsequent advances in management information systems have helped to codify project management practices; most recently, the Internet has dramatically enhanced the ability of individuals, teams, and organizations to manage projects across continents and cultures in real time.
